Austrian industry demands help amid tenfold increase in cost of natural gas
Georg Knill, president of the Federation of Austrian Industry Industrie Vereinigung, said that the increase in cost of natural gas tenfold drove Austrian companies into a crisis, which can be overcome only with large-scale help from the state. He said this in a conversation with the Kronenzeitung.
“The situation is more than dramatic. Many businesses have gone to extremes,” Knill said.
The Kronenzeitung piece notes that the Austrian Cabinet had previously promised to increase support for producers, but so far this has not happened. The president of the Industrie Vereinigung, stressed that if there is no support, Austria will face plant closures and unemployment.
Increasing gas prices – what happens to other countries?
On September 4, it became known that the Finnish authorities in the framework of the aid program, prepared loans and guarantees for up to €10 billion for energy companies.
Before that, on the same day, it was reported that the government of Sweden intends to provide the national energy companies 250 billion SEK ($23.18 billion) for liquidity guarantees to maintain financial stability against increasing gas prices.
On September 3, the average settlement price of gas in Europe in August jumped 35%, to $2,450 per thousand cubic meters, and also for the first time reached a record $3,500 amid a complete stop of Nord Stream.
